
During September 2025, Justin Joseph enhanced data integration and reliability across the apache/opendal and risingwavelabs/risingwave repositories. He implemented S3 rate limiting handling by mapping HTTP 429 responses to a retryable RateLimited error, improving error handling for S3-compatible services. In risingwave, he added Avro enum type support to the Kafka sink, updating the Avro encoder to map varchar values to enum symbols and expanding integration tests for various enum scenarios. Working primarily in Rust and Shell, Justin focused on backend development and cloud services integration, delivering well-tested features that improved data pipeline resiliency and interoperability for production environments.

Summary for 2025-09: Delivered high-impact reliability and data integration enhancements across two repositories, focusing on S3 compatibility and Kafka sink capabilities. The work emphasizes business value through improved resiliency, correctness, and interoperability, backed by tests and clear commit-level traceability.
Summary for 2025-09: Delivered high-impact reliability and data integration enhancements across two repositories, focusing on S3 compatibility and Kafka sink capabilities. The work emphasizes business value through improved resiliency, correctness, and interoperability, backed by tests and clear commit-level traceability.
Overview of all repositories you've contributed to across your timeline